Web1 The PELs are 8-hour TWAs unless otherwise noted; a (C) designation denotes a ceiling limit. They are to be determined from breathing-zone air samples. (a) Parts of vapor or gas per million parts of contaminated air by volume at 25 °C and 760 torr. (b) Milligrams of substance per cubic meter of air. What is it? A hazardous chemical inventory list is simply a list of all products your practice has that have hazardous properties. The hazardous chemical inventory list is an OSHA-required item—and one of the first things an OSHA inspector will want to see.

Hazard Communication Standard, requires employers to make a chemical inventory list of the hazardous … WebChemical Inventory List A chemical inventory list will be developed by the program administrator. The master list will be kept at the main office. A project-specific chemical inventory list will be developed for each project and maintained at the jobsite along with the appropriate MSDSs.
